Libelfin is a from-scratch C++11 library for reading ELF binaries and DWARFv4 debug information.

Quick start

make, and optionally make install. You'll need GCC 4.7 or later.

Non-features

Libelfin implements a syntactic layer for DWARF and ELF, but not a semantic layer. Interpreting the information stored in DWARF DIE trees still requires a great deal of understanding of DWARF, but libelfin will make sense of the bytes for you.

Using libelfin

To build against libdwarf++, use, for example

g++ -std=c++11 a.cc $(pkg-config --cflags --libs libdwarf++)

To use a local build of libelfin, set PKG_CONFIG_PATH. For example,

export PKG_CONFIG_PATH=$PWD/elf:$PWD/dwarf

There are various example programs in examples/.

Status

Libelfin is a good start. It's not production-ready and there are many parts of the DWARF specification it does not yet implement, but it's complete enough to be useful for many things and is a good deal more pleasant to use than every other debug info library I've tried.
